v4.1: Added Model comparison. Not yet ready but can be used. The preprocessor, surprisingly, seems to sort the compared models (listed after the model_comparison command) by decreasing order of the model names (including path and extension).

TODO: 
+ Add an option to define the benchmark model (bayes ratio).
+ Add comparison to estimated BVAR models.
